5535443044 has 12 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 9687573868. Its totient is φ = 2767564800.
The previous prime is 5535443041. The next prime is 5535443047. The reversal of 5535443044 is 4403445355.
It is an interprime number because it is at equal distance from previous prime (5535443041) and next prime (5535443047).
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 2 ways, for example, as 2780452900 + 2754990144 = 52730^2 + 52488^2 .
It is a super-2 number, since 2×55354430442 = 61282259386735971872, which contains 22 as substring.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 5535442994 and 5535443012.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(5535443041)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(13)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 81784 + ... + 133264.
Almost surely, 25535443044 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
5535443044 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(4152130824).
5535443044 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
5535443044 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 78366 (or 78364 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 288000, while the sum is 37.
The square root of 5535443044 is about 74400.5580893047. The cubic root of 5535443044 is about 1768.9577576732.
Adding to 5535443044 its reverse (4403445355), we get a palindrome (9938888399).
The spelling of 5535443044 in words is "five billion, five hundred thirty-five million, four hundred forty-three thousand, forty-four".
